About The Position

Reporting to the Director, Governance, Controls and Finance Operations, the Senior Manager, Finance Operations and Governance, will play a significant role in management of the relationship and deliverables related to CIBC’s external auditor, management of the Disclosure Committee process and support other Finance risk and governance deliverables, including other committees, projects or initiatives in Finance. You will work directly with the Chief Accountant, SOX office, CIBC's internal and external auditors, and senior executives across the bank. You will also work with the Finance Governance and Controls team, the Chief Accountants department, and other Finance LOBs. Responsibilities

  • Manage key relationships with senior stakeholders and collaborate with business partners across the Bank and the external auditor.
  • Influence without authority, provide leadership and effectively manage deliverables from various stakeholders including peers and subject matter experts within and outside of Finance, by influencing, coaching, and negotiating.
  • Prepare materials for senior executives and committees; and review engagement letters, contracts, and other deliverables.
  • Resolve issues and find creative and efficient solutions.
  • Provide coaching and guidance to the junior members on the team to successfully deliver on collective accountabilities.
  • Project manage the end-to-end deliverables for the Disclosure Committee meetings and ensure timely and quality delivery.
  • Coordinate with various subject matter experts within Finance to develop Disclosure Committee materials for Disclosure Committee members and Responsible Officers.
  • Facilitate the drafting of the Disclosure Committee agenda, quarterly/annual assertions, minutes, speaking notes, etc.
  • Oversee and manage the Disclosure Committee SharePoint site and ensure compliance with Records Management policy.
  • Provide support to other Committees (i.e., Audit Committee, etc.) in Finance as required.
  • Support deliverables to key stakeholders, including SOX Office and Internal Audit that are within the Finance Governance, Controls and Operations mandate.
  • Support the simplification and automation initiatives for Finance Governance, Controls and Operations team and other Finance risk, governance and controls deliverables as required.
  • Participate in and manage other initiatives or projects in support of Finance that fall under the responsibility of Finance Governance, Controls and Operations.
